## Router Diagnostics
The `router_diagnostics` field of the MaxCtrl `show service` and the service
REST API output for a readwritesplit service contains the following fields.
* `queries`: Number of queries executed through this service.
* `route_master`: Number of writes routed to master.
* `route_slave`: Number of reads routed to slaves.
* `route_all`: Number of session commands routed to all servers.
* `rw_transactions`: Number of explicit read-write transactions.
* `ro_transactions`: Number of explicit read-only transactions.
* `replayed_transactions`: Number of replayed transactions.
* `server_query_statistics`: Statistics for each configured and used server consisting of the following fields.
* `id`: Name of the server
* `total`: Total number of queries.
* `read`: Total number of reads.
* `write`: Total number of writes.
* `avg_sess_duration`: Average duration of a client session to this server.
* `avg_sess_active_pct`: Average percentage of time client sessions were active. 0% means connections were opened but never used.
* `avg_selects_per_session`: Average number of selects per session.
